  • Patent number: 11964342
    Abstract: A laser processing apparatus includes: a stage 2 capable of levitating and transporting a substrate 3 by jetting gas from a front surface; a laser oscillator configured to irradiate a laser beam 20a onto the substrate 3; and a gas jetting port arranged at a position overlapping a focus point position of the laser beam 20a in plan view, and being configured to jet inert gas. The front surface of the stage 2 is constituted by upper structures 5a and 5b, and the upper structures 5a and 5b are arranged so as to be spaced apart from each other and face each other. A gap between the upper structures 5a and 5b overlaps the focus point position of the laser beam 20a in plan view. A filling member 8 is arranged between the upper structures 5a and 5b so as to fill the gap between the upper structures 5a and 5b.

  • Patent number: 7289282
    Abstract: A lens barrel for holding a lens includes a barrel body for containing the lens. A ring shaped receiving wall is formed on the barrel body, for receiving a rear face of a peripheral portion of the lens, to position the lens in an optical axis direction. Three retaining claw portions are disposed to project from the barrel body, for retaining the lens on the ring shaped receiving wall by engagement with the peripheral portion thereof. Three first through holes are formed in the barrel body, and adapted to insertion and pressure of an external adjusting rod for positioning adjustment of the lens. Second through holes are formed in the barrel body, and adapted to introduction of adhesive agent for attaching the lens on the barrel body. The retaining claw portions and the first through holes are arranged at a regular pitch on a circumference of the barrel body.

  • Publication number: 20070229770
    Abstract: A first fixing plate 51, which is bonded to a G light prism 29 and which holds a G light DMD unit 50, is formed of a metal plate having a liner coefficient of expansion, which is substantially the same as that of the G light prism 29. The G light DMD unit 50 is fixed by inserting holding projections 51b into through holes 64 and inserting fixing holes 52a of a second fixing plate 52 into the holding projections 51b protruding through the through holes 64. The fixing holes 52a of the second fixing plate 52 have a shape similar to a section shape of the holding projections 51b taken along a plane perpendicular to the insertion direction. A gap between each holding projection 51b and the corresponding fixing hole 52a is uniform in an overall circumference. A thickness of the adhesive filled in this gap is uniform.

  • Patent number: 7012760
    Abstract: To the female helicoidal screw of the lens barrel (outer barrel body), there is always imparted a biasing force from a plurality of looseness eliminating springs formed on the outside peripheral portion of the lens barrel (inner barrel body) which are integrally supported on the lens barrel (inner barrel body), by means of the male helicoidal screw, and the male helicoidal screw is slid while being thrusted against the female helicoidal screw.
